Unleashing Luxury: The Ultimate Guide to Renting a Car in California

California, known for its stunning coastlines, vibrant cities, and picturesque landscapes, offers the perfect backdrop for an unforgettable driving experience.

https://wakelet.com/wake/SPxVjQtQxTZYN8XqTRKaN